How do I fry French fries?
First and foremost, the choice of potato can be determining for the success of the Belgian fries. Best to use are frying potatoes, which are recognizable by their size and hardness. Then you have to peel the potatoes and wash them thoroughly. Important is that you have to dry the washed potatoes with a dry and clean kitchen towel. Now you can slice the potatoes into strips.
Frying fresh Belgian fries in 2 steps :
1 Pre frying (Here the Belgian fries get done) Set the deep fryer on 150°C-170°C (depending on the season and the type of potatoes) and let the frying fat warm up, then fry the Belgian fries for about 5 minutes (depending on the thickness of your Belgian fries). Lift out the basket from the deep fryer and let the Belgian fries cool down for a few minutes in the basket or in a bowl.
2 Boiling down (Which makes the Belgian fries nice golden brown and crunchy) Heat up the frying fat to 190° C and fry the Belgian fries for a second time, about 3 minutes (depending on how brown you like them) and put them in a bowl with kitchen paper on the bottom.
